Beef back ribs can be harder to find in butcher shops than short ribs, but chef David Burtka serves them on Halloween because they resemble human ribs. Here, he braises them in Coca-Cola and brushes them with homemade barbecue sauce before grilling them.

This was my favorite barbecue sauce growing up. It's vinegar-based with no ketchup. It's very tangy, very thin, and wonderful on pork, chicken, and even tofu!

Ingredients:
white vinegar, cayenne pepper, black pepper, mustard, salt, lemons, worcestershire sauce
